Scottsdale, Arizona
Scottsdale Water 2025 Water Quality Report. Hardness prints by zone — south of Indian School 13–15 gpg / 230–260 ppm, Indian School to Chaparral 13–17 gpg / 215–285 ppm, north of Chaparral 13–17 gpg / 230–290 ppm. Chlorine 0.65 ppm average (range 0–1.5). No Measure S-style residential softener ban turned up.

Salt-free conditioner
A salt-free conditioner changes how scale sticks. It does not soften. Soap and spots stay closer to untreated. No brine line.
Whole-house carbon for chlorine
That is chlorine. A whole-house carbon filter with an NSF/ANSI 42 chlorine claim is the usual match. A softener will not take chlorine out.

On the report
- Water utility
- Scottsdale Water
- Hardness
- Approximate hardness levels table — south of Indian School Road 13–15 grains per gallon (230–260 mg/L or ppm). Indian School Road to Chaparral Road 13–17 gpg (215–285 ppm). North of Chaparral Road 13–17 gpg (230–290 ppm). Those are three labeled zones, not a blended citywide number. 2025 Water Quality Report. — Scottsdale Water 2025 Water Quality Report
- Disinfectant
- Chlorine lowest amount detected 0 ppm, highest 1.5 ppm, average 0.65 ppm. MRDL 4, MRDLG 4. Water additive used to control microbial growth. 2025 distribution table. — Scottsdale Water 2025 Water Quality Report
- Brine / salt to the sewer
- No district prohibition found in current research. Searched Scottsdale Water and City of Scottsdale sewer pages and codes for a residential self-regenerating softener or brine-drain ban like LACSD Measure S. None turned up. Ask the sewer agency on the bill before you cut a brine drain.
